    I have a community calendar site that currently runs Events Calendar Pro, Community Events, and Facebook Events. We also plan to start selling items with Woo Commerce AND purchase WooTickets for event ticket sales. I plan on purchasing a known compatible theme from Woothemes to go with this set-up.

    We get a respectable amount of traffic (this is a hyperlocal site), but I’m concerned about the size and scope of the site once I activate all these plug-ins. Are there any known issues with running all of these plug-ins at once?

    Hi Lauren,

    There are no known issues I’m aware of.

    It’s simply a very difficult question to answer with a ton of variables. How many visitors/sec will you have at peak time … what server resources are available and how is your server configured (what server is it? Apache, nginx?) … are visitors likely to carry out actions that might be more resource intensive than normal … will query caching (and other caching layers) be implemented … we just can’t give an answer, I’m afraid.

    I totally appreciate you want to go into this with your eyes open, but all I can suggest is either giving it a go (and having a strategy in place to scale out) or setting up a duplicate site and subjecting it to a battery of tests to see how it performs.
